词汇 callous
释义

callous

adjective
/ˈkæləs/
/ˈkæləs/
  1. not caring about other people’s feelings, pain or problems冷酷无情的;无同情心的;冷漠的 synonym cruel, unfeeling
    • a callous killer/attitude/act冷血杀手;漠不关心的态度;冷酷的行为
    • a callous disregard for the feelings of others对他人感情的漠视
    • He was convicted of the particularly callous murder of two teenage boys.他被判犯有特别残忍的谋杀两个十几岁男孩的罪行。
    • I still can't believe they were so callous.我仍然无法相信他们如此冷酷无情。
    • The troops showed a callous disregard for life and property.那支部队对生命和财产表现得麻木不仁。
    Collocations DictionaryCallous is used with these nouns:
    • disregard
    • indifference
    词源late Middle English (in the Latin sense): from Latin callosus ‘hard-skinned’.
